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 88001-22-3 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 8,8,0,0 and 1 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 2 and 2 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 88001-22:
(7*8)+(6*8)+(5*0)+(4*0)+(3*1)+(2*2)+(1*2)=113
113 % 10 = 3
So 88001-22-3 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Stereoselective E and Z Olefin Formation by Wittig Olefination of Aldehydes with Allylic Phosphorus Ylides. Stereochemistry

Tamura, Rui,Saegusa, Koji,Kakihana, Masato,Oda, Daihei

, p. 2723 - 2728 (2007/10/02)

Sterically crowded allylic tributylphosphorus ylides such as β-γ-disubstituted allylic ylides react with various aldehydes to afford E olefins with high stereoselectivity (E>92percent).As the steric demand of the ylides was decreased, bulky aldehydes were required to achieve high E selectivity.On the other hand, predominant or exclusive formation of Z olefins was achieved by using allylic triphenylphosphorus ylides and tertiary aldehydes like pivaldehyde, while the combination of allylic triphenylphosphorus ylides and such large secondary aldehydes as cyclohexanecarboxaldehyde led to E olefin formation under the lithium salt free conditions.The distinct lithium salt effect was observed in the reaction effected with triphenylphosphorus ylides.The origin of the observed E or Z selectivity can be reasonably explained according to Vedejs' rationale on the Wittig reaction stereochemistry.
